DoubleZero Protocol Set for Mainnet Launch in September 2025

Austin Federa, former Head of Strategy at the Solana Foundation, is launching DoubleZero, a protocol aimed at enhancing blockchain communication and scalability. Key points include:

  • DoubleZero aims to be faster than the public internet, crucial for crypto trades.
  • 12.57% of staked SOL operates on the DoubleZero testnet, with the mainnet expected in September.
  • The protocol allows multiple contributors to create a high-performance fiber mesh network globally.
  • It supports Solana first due to its unique transaction-to-node ratio.
  • The stake pool currently has around 3 million SOL, intended to subsidize validator costs on the testnet.
  • Mainnet will feature over 50 fiber links, significantly increasing data transmission capacity.
  • DoubleZero intends to facilitate higher limits for Solana protocol designers while maintaining lower latency connections.
  • There are fallback options to the public internet if issues arise within the DoubleZero network.
  • A token launch is planned alongside the mainnet launch in September.
